Maldini confirms Giroud’s Milan arrival

AC Milan director Paolo Maldini confirmed Wednesday that Chelsea’s French center-forward Olivier Giroud was set to arrive in Italy.

Maldini said this at the unveiling of the Serie A calendar for the 2021-2022 season.

The 34-year old World Cup winner is reported to be set to sign a two-year contract worth three million euros per season with the Serie A runners-up, who open next season at Sampdoria.

Milan’s star striker Zlatan Ibrahimovic, who is 39, underwent knee surgery in Rome in June and remains uncertain for the start of the coming campaign.

Giroud joined Chelsea after six seasons with Arsenal in January 2018.

He arrived in England from Montpellier with whom he won Ligue 1. In England, between Chelsea and Arsenal he has won four FA Cups and three Community Shields.

He won the Europa League and Champions League with Chelsea.
